Subject: Joint Venture Proposal — Tarrowgate Energy

Dear executive team,

Tarrowgate Energy has formally proposed a joint venture covering grid-storage installations in the Lindmere corridor. Their proposal includes shared capital commitments and a five-year exclusivity clause. Department heads should review the attached assessment before Thursday's call. The strategic considerations are summarised in the confidential note below.

management briefing: Project Ulavan slips by two quarters because of the staffing delay.

Subject: Sunsetting the Brightlane Kits

Hi all,

Quick heads-up before Thursday's board session: we're officially retiring the Brightlane accessory line. Margins have slipped for six straight quarters, and Tova's team confirmed support costs keep climbing. Remaining inventory moves through outlet channels by spring. Customers migrate to the Corvid platform. The strategic rationale is summarized in the confidential note below.

internal memo for yahag-hahig: Belwynix Group plans to lower the Silir list price by 62 percent in May.

## Releases

CatalogCache releases for the Fennwick product catalog are cut weekly. Each build purges stale invalidation manifests before packaging; verify the purge log in CI artifacts. All release tarballs are signed prior to upload. Reviewers must confirm the signature against the key below.

rollout seal: bky4_DFM9